Wahab Apologises to Lagos Residents Over Mounting Waste Challenge

The Lagos State Government has apologized to residents over persistent waste management challenges, assuring them that measures are underway to restore cleanliness and improve the state’s waste disposal system.

The Commissioner for the Environment and Water Resources, Mr Tokunbo Wahab, gave the assurance in a statement reposted on his official X handle on Friday following an interview on ARISE Television.

“We had a challenge, and we are fixing it,” Wahab said, acknowledging the concerns raised by residents over waste collection across the state.

The commissioner explained that Lagos was undergoing a major transition from its traditional linear waste management system to a circular economy model that treats waste as a valuable resource rather than refuse.

According to him, the new strategy aims to promote environmental sustainability while unlocking economic opportunities through waste recycling and resource recovery.

As part of the reforms, Wahab disclosed that the state had commissioned a food waste digester at Ikosi to convert organic waste into clean energy.

He said the project, funded and piloted by C-40, aligns with the state’s long-term vision of building a sustainable and climate-resilient waste management system.

Wahab noted that the initiative is part of the Lagos State Government’s broader efforts to modernize waste management infrastructure, reduce environmental pollution, and improve sanitation across communities.

He reaffirmed the government’s commitment to strengthening waste management operations and ensuring cleaner, healthier neighborhoods for all residents.
